The Chinese delegates are pictured parading in the stadium at the opening ceremony of the 1984 Los Angeles Olympic Games on June 28, 1984 file photo. After 52 years, Los Angeles witnessed Chinese sport in another crucial moment, that is, for the first time, China sent a large delegate to take part in the Olympic Games. [Photo/Xinhua]

Xu Haifeng (R), a Chinese pistol shooter and the first person to win a gold medal for China in the Olympic Games, celebrates after winning a gold medal at the 1984 Los Angeles Olympic Games, while his teammate Wang Yifu (L) wins bronze, July 29, 1984, file photo. Xu became a coach for China's national shooting team after retiring in 1995. He was the first torchbearer to bring the Olympic torch into the Beijing National Stadium, also known as "Bird's Nest," near the end of the opening ceremony of the 2008 Summer Olympics.
